A numeric keypad, also known as a numpad, is a dedicated section of a keyboard that features digits 0 through 9, mathematical operators, and an Enter key arranged in a compact grid format. It is designed for efficient single-handed data entry and rapid calculation.
This specialized input tool exists to streamline tasks that involve heavy numerical input. Standard horizontal number rows require wide hand movements, but the numpad groups everything into a tight space, allowing users to type numbers by touch alone. You will find them built into standard full-sized desktop keyboards or available as standalone external devices used alongside compact laptops and tenkeyless keyboards.

The standard grid layout of the numeric keypad dates back to early adding machines and calculators in the mid-twentieth century. When IBM introduced the Model F and Model M keyboards for personal computers in the 1980s, they integrated the dedicated 17-key numeric pad on the right side. This layout became an industry standard, allowing computer users to transition seamlessly from analog accounting tools to digital spreadsheets.
The numeric keypad operates like any other input device by sending specific scan codes to the computer operating system when a key is pressed. However, its defining mechanical feature is the Num Lock (Number Lock) toggle key.
When Num Lock is active, the keys register as numbers and mathematical symbols. When Num Lock is turned off, the keypad switches to its secondary function, mapping the keys to navigation commands such as arrow keys, Home, End, Page Up, and Page Down. This dual mapping allows a single hardware cluster to serve two entirely different workflows.
Integrated Keypads: Built directly into the right side of standard full-sized 100% layout keyboards.
Standalone External Keypads: Separate peripherals that connect via USB cable or Bluetooth, ideal for laptop users and minimalist setups.
Mechanical Keypads: Standalone or built-in numpads utilizing individual mechanical switches for superior tactile feedback and durability.
Membrane Keypads: Budget-friendly options that use pressure-sensitive rubber domes underneath the keys.

Increased Speed: The grid layout dramatically reduces the time needed to type long sequences of digits.
Reduced Fatigue: Minimizes hand movement and allows the user to keep one hand free for documentation or a mouse.
Improved Accuracy: Enables muscle memory development so users can type numbers without looking down.
Ergonomic Strain: Built-in keypads force the mouse further to the right, forcing an unnatural shoulder alignment during long sessions.
Desk Footprint: Keyboards with integrated numpads require significantly more physical desk space.
Portability Issues: Laptops with built-in numpads are larger, heavier, and less travel-friendly.
Finance and Accounting: Entering data into spreadsheets, executing formulas in Excel, and managing bookkeeping software.
Data Entry: Rapidly inputting inventory codes, phone numbers, and statistical figures into databases.
Gaming: Binding complex macros, buy menus in tactical shooters, or flight simulator controls to the grid.
Accessibility: Using the "mouse keys" feature to control the on-screen cursor using the keypad numbers.

Calculator and computer keypads feature the 7, 8, 9 keys on the top row, while telephone keypads place the 1, 2, 3 keys on the top row. This distinction was originally designed to prevent data entry clerks from dialing phone numbers too fast for early switching systems to handle.
Tenkeyless (TKL): A keyboard layout that completely removes the numeric keypad to save space.
Form Factor: The physical size and shape configuration of computer hardware like keyboards.
Macro Key: A programmable key that executes a series of commands or keystrokes with a single press.
Scan Code: The digital signal a keyboard sends to a computer to identify which key was pressed.
